Police say they charged a Guelph teenager after a cell phone was found in a girls’ washroom at a south-end elementary school.

On Monday afternoon, authorities said a pair of 13-year-old girls used the school washroom and noticed a hidden cell phone, which was recording video.

The phone was then turned over to staff before police were called.

Later Monday evening, a teen boy came into the police station with his parents and was arrested.

A 13-year-old boy has been charged with voyeurism and is scheduled to appear in a courtroom in Guelph in August.
